The hyperbaric oxygen chamber at home operates by increasing atmospheric pressure to approximately 1.3 to 1.5 times normal levels, allowing the body to absorb substantially more oxygen through the bloodstream and tissues. Modern home units feature sophisticated pressure control systems, medical-grade oxygen concentrators, and user-friendly digital interfaces that make operation simple and safe for daily use. These chambers utilize dual-layer construction with medical-grade materials, ensuring durability and safety standards that meet residential requirements. The technological features include automated pressure regulation, emergency release valves, internal communication systems, and comfortable seating or lying arrangements. Most hyperbaric oxygen chamber at home models incorporate clear viewing windows, allowing users to maintain visual contact with the outside environment during sessions. Advanced units include entertainment systems, climate control, and smartphone connectivity for enhanced user experience. Applications span from general wellness enhancement and athletic recovery to supporting various health conditions under professional guidance. The chamber works by delivering oxygen-enriched air under controlled pressure, promoting enhanced cellular oxygenation throughout the body. This process supports natural healing mechanisms, potentially improving energy levels, cognitive function, and overall vitality. Safety mechanisms include multiple pressure relief systems, air filtration units, and emergency protocols. The hyperbaric oxygen chamber at home typically accommodates single users comfortably, with session durations ranging from 60 to 90 minutes depending on individual protocols and professional recommendations.
